Second model component 204 can generate one or more causal graphs based on runtime traces of test cases executed on a monolithic application to capture first order temporal dependencies and/or high order temporal dependencies of the monolithic application and/or the cluster assignments of classes in the monolithic application. For example, second model component 204 can generate the one or more causal graphs described above with reference to